Alabama Escapes Against Tennessee, 31-24

Article By: BIGmike

Tuscaloosa, Alabama - The Alabama Crimson Tide picked up a huge conference win today, defeating the Volunteers of Tennessee 31-24. The Crimson Tide offense looked like a well-oiled machine in the first half, totaling over 300 yards of offense and 4 touchdowns to take a commanding 28-3 lead into the break. In the second half however, momentum shifted, and the Volunteers dug down deep to make it a one touchdown lead with just over 2 minutes to play. Facing a third and short the Crimson Tide elected to pass the ball, and it looked as though Jalen Milroe was going to end up on the turf, but he managed to shrug off the sack attempt and scramble for 13 yards sealing the victory for the Tide. Running back Jam Miller was presented the game ball for his performance, totaling 252 yards (201 rushing, 51 receiving) and 3 touchdowns. "We need this one after last week," said coach McDonagh at the post-game press conference. "To pick up a win against a hated rival in front of your home crowd and in that fashion? That's why we play this game." Up next for the Crimson Tide is a trip to Columbia, Missouri to take on coach McDonagh's former team the Tigers.
